Canadian championship set to kick off

Change is in the air north of the border, where a fourth team and a new format make for some intriguing action in the 2011 Nutrilite Canadian Championship, which kicks off Wednesday evening.

With the addition of NASL side FC Edmonton, the championships have moved from a three-team, round-robin format to a four-team, knockout stage-style tournament.
